Preparing the Eyes
A. Properly grooming and shaping eyebrows
One of the key factors in achieving the dead eyes look is to have well-groomed and shaped eyebrows. This helps to frame the eyes and create a more captivating and eerie gaze. Start by brushing the eyebrows with a spoolie brush to remove any stray hairs. Then, using a pair of tweezers, carefully pluck any excess hairs that are outside the natural shape of your eyebrows. Be sure to follow the natural arch of your brows and avoid over-plucking, as this can make the gaze appear unnatural. If necessary, fill in any sparse areas with a brow pencil or powder that matches your natural hair color.
B. Enhancing lash length and thickness with mascara or false lashes
To further enhance the eyes and create a captivating gaze, it is essential to enhance the length and thickness of your lashes. You can achieve this through the use of mascara or false lashes. Apply a coat of mascara to your upper and lower lashes, making sure to wiggle the wand from the base to the tip to add volume. Consider using a mascara formula that specifically promotes lengthening and thickening. If you prefer a more dramatic effect, opt for false lashes. Trim the lashes to fit your eye shape, apply lash adhesive along the strip, and carefully press them onto your lash line.

IChoosing the Right Eye Makeup
A. Selecting dark eyeshadow shades
When aiming to achieve a captivating and eerie gaze, choosing the right eyeshadow shades is crucial. Dark and intense colors will help create the desired effect. Opt for shades such as deep purples, blacks, grays, or smokey browns. These shades will add depth and mystery to your eyes, enhancing the overall look.
To apply the eyeshadow, start by priming your eyelids to ensure longer-lasting color and prevent creasing. Using a small, dense brush, gently pat the eyeshadow onto your lid, starting at the outer corner and blending it towards the center. Build up the color gradually for a more dramatic effect.
B. Using eyeliner to create defined and intense eyes
Eyeliner can play a significant role in achieving the captivating and eerie gaze. It helps define the eyes and intensify their appearance. A black or dark brown eyeliner is ideal for this look.
To apply eyeliner, start from the inner corner of the eye and draw a thin line close to the lash line. For a more intense look, create a winged or cat-eye effect by extending the line slightly beyond the outer corner of the eye. This will give a dramatic and captivating appearance.
For a more intense effect, consider tightlining your upper waterline as well. This involves applying eyeliner to the upper waterline, creating the illusion of fuller lashes and adding depth to the eyes.
Remember to smudge or blend the eyeliner slightly to soften the line and create a more seamless look. This will prevent harsh lines and give a more natural yet captivating finish.

IApplying Eye Makeup Techniques
A. Smokey-eye technique for a mysterious effect
The smokey-eye technique is a classic makeup look that can add a touch of mystery and allure to your gaze. To achieve the dead eyes look, the smokey-eye technique can be modified slightly to enhance its eerie and captivating qualities.
1. Begin by applying a neutral base eyeshadow all over the eyelids and blend it up towards the brow bone.
2. Choose a dark eyeshadow shade, such as black, dark gray, or deep burgundy, and apply it to the outer corner of the eyes, creating a shape like a sideways “V”. Use a blending brush to softly blend the color towards the center of the eyelid.
3. Apply the same dark eyeshadow shade along the lower lash line, connecting it with the outer corner of the upper lid.
4. Use a smudging brush to blend the eyeshadow, creating a seamless transition between the dark color and the neutral base.
5. To further intensify the effect, apply a shimmery eyeshadow in a similar dark shade to the center of the eyelid. This will create a striking contrast and add depth to the overall look.
6. Finish the smokey-eye by applying a generous coat of black mascara to the top and bottom lashes.
B. Cut crease technique to add depth and intensity
The cut crease technique is another eye makeup technique that can add depth and intensity to your gaze. By creating a distinct separation between the eyelid and the crease, this technique can give your eyes a haunting and alluring appearance.
1. Start by applying a matte eyeshadow shade that is slightly lighter than your skin tone all over the eyelid. This will act as a base color.
2. Using a thin eyeliner brush, apply a dark eyeshadow shade along the crease of the eyelid, creating a sharp, defined line. This will be the “cut” in the cut crease technique.
3. Use a blending brush to blend the dark eyeshadow shade upwards towards the brow bone, creating a gradient effect.
4. Apply a shimmery eyeshadow shade to the eyelid, below the cut crease line. This will add dimension and intensity to the look.
5. Finish the cut crease look by applying black eyeliner along the upper lash line and extending it slightly outwards for a cat-eye effect. Apply a coat of black mascara to complete the captivating and eerie gaze.

Lightening the Under-Eye Area
A. Using concealer to create a paler effect
To achieve the captivating and eerie dead eyes look, it is essential to lighten the under-eye area. This step helps create a pale and haunting effect that adds depth and intensity to the gaze. One way to achieve this is by using concealer.
Start by choosing a concealer that is one to two shades lighter than your natural skin tone. This lighter shade will help create a stark contrast between your under-eye area and the rest of your face. Apply the concealer using a small brush or your fingertips, gently blending it into your skin.
Make sure to cover any dark circles or discoloration under the eyes thoroughly. The goal is to create a seamless, pale complexion in this area. Take your time and build up the coverage gradually, as too much product can result in a cakey appearance.
B. Brightening the inner corners of the eyes
In addition to using concealer, brightening the inner corners of the eyes can further enhance the eerie and captivating dead eyes look. This technique helps draw attention to the center of your gaze and creates a mesmerizing effect.
To achieve this, choose a shimmery or light eyeshadow shade. It can be a pale gold, silver, or even a white shade, depending on your desired effect. Using a small eyeshadow brush, apply the brightening shade to the inner corners of your eyes, gently blending it outwards.
Be careful not to overdo it, as you want a subtle and ethereal glow rather than a heavy, glittery effect. The goal is to create a soft illumination in the inner corners, enhancing the overall intensity of your gaze.
Remember to blend the eyeshadow seamlessly with the rest of your eye makeup to create a cohesive look. Use a clean blending brush to ensure a flawless transition between shades.

Safety Considerations
Consulting with an Optometrist before Using Decorative Contact Lenses
Achieving the captivating and eerie dead eyes look often involves the use of decorative contact lenses with unique designs. These lenses can add depth and intensity to your gaze, enhancing the overall effect. However, it is important to prioritize safety and consult with an optometrist before using them.
Decorative contact lenses, also known as cosmetic or fashion contact lenses, are not medical devices. They do not correct vision and should only be used for cosmetic purposes. It is crucial to consult with an optometrist to ensure that your eyes are healthy and suitable for wearing contact lenses.
An optometrist can conduct a comprehensive eye exam to assess your eye health and determine if you have any underlying conditions that may be worsened by wearing contact lenses. They can also measure your eyes and provide expert advice on proper lens fitting and care.
Furthermore, optometrists can guide you on where to purchase reliable and safe decorative contact lenses. It is crucial to buy lenses from reputable sources to avoid counterfeit or low-quality products that may cause damage to your eyes.
Avoiding Eye Strain and Discomfort
While achieving the dead eyes look can be visually striking, it is essential to prioritize eye health and comfort. Long durations of intense eye makeup or wearing contact lenses can lead to eye strain and discomfort.
To avoid these issues, it is recommended to take regular breaks when wearing contact lenses or applying heavy eye makeup. This allows your eyes to rest and recover from any strain caused by the use of decorative lenses or extensive eye makeup techniques.
Practicing good eye care habits is important, not only to prevent eye strain but also to maintain overall eye health. This includes getting enough sleep, staying hydrated, eating a balanced diet, and avoiding excessive screen time.
If you experience any discomfort, redness, or vision problems while wearing contact lenses or using eye makeup, it is crucial to remove the lenses immediately and seek professional advice from an optometrist. Ignoring these signs may lead to further complications and potentially damage your eyes.
